Remember to maintain security and privacy. Do not share sensitive information. Procedimento.com.br may make mistakes. Verify important information. Termo de Responsabilidade

Explorando as funcionalidades do Snap+Camera no Windows

Público-Alvo: Usuários intermediários

O Snap+Camera é uma ferramenta poderosa do Windows que permite aos usuários tirar o máximo proveito de suas câmeras e webcams. Com recursos avançados e fáceis de usar, o Snap+Camera oferece uma variedade de opções para capturar fotos e vídeos, aplicar filtros e efeitos em tempo real e até mesmo transmitir ao vivo para plataformas populares. Neste artigo, exploraremos algumas das funcionalidades do Snap+Camera e como elas podem ser úteis no dia a dia.

Exemplos:

  1. Capturando fotos e vídeos: O Snap+Camera permite que você capture fotos e vídeos de maneira simples e intuitiva. Com apenas alguns cliques, você pode acessar sua câmera ou webcam e começar a gravar. Veja o exemplo de código abaixo:

    using System;
    using System.Threading.Tasks;
    using Windows.Media.Capture;
    
    public class CameraCapture
    {
       private MediaCapture mediaCapture;
    
       public async Task StartCapture()
       {
           mediaCapture = new MediaCapture();
           await mediaCapture.InitializeAsync();
    
           var photoFile = await Windows.Storage.KnownFolders.PicturesLibrary.CreateFileAsync("photo.jpg", Windows.Storage.CreationCollisionOption.GenerateUniqueName);
           await mediaCapture.CapturePhotoToStorageFileAsync(Windows.Media.MediaProperties.ImageEncodingProperties.CreateJpeg(), photoFile);
    
           var videoFile = await Windows.Storage.KnownFolders.VideosLibrary.CreateFileAsync("video.mp4", Windows.Storage.CreationCollisionOption.GenerateUniqueName);
           await mediaCapture.StartRecordToStorageFileAsync(Windows.Media.MediaProperties.MediaEncodingProfile.CreateMp4(Windows.Media.MediaProperties.VideoEncodingQuality.Auto), videoFile);
       }
    }
  2. Aplicando filtros e efeitos em tempo real: Uma das grandes vantagens do Snap+Camera é a capacidade de aplicar filtros e efeitos em tempo real durante a captura de fotos e vídeos. Isso permite que você adicione um toque especial às suas criações. Veja o exemplo de código abaixo:

    using System;
    using Windows.Media.Effects;
    using Windows.Media.MediaProperties;
    using Windows.Media.Capture;
    
    public class CameraEffects
    {
       private MediaCapture mediaCapture;
    
       public async Task ApplyEffect()
       {
           mediaCapture = new MediaCapture();
           await mediaCapture.InitializeAsync();
    
           var videoDevice = mediaCapture.VideoDeviceController;
           var effectDefinition = new FilterEffectDefinition("Windows.Media.VideoEffects.VideoGrayscale");
           var effect = await videoDevice.AddVideoEffectAsync(effectDefinition, MediaStreamType.VideoPreview);
    
           await mediaCapture.StartPreviewAsync();
       }
    }

Aproveite ao máximo suas câmeras e webcams no Windows com o Snap+Camera! Com suas funcionalidades avançadas e fáceis de usar, você pode capturar fotos e vídeos incríveis, aplicar filtros e efeitos em tempo real e até mesmo transmitir ao vivo para suas plataformas favoritas. Compartilhe este artigo com seus amigos e descubra como o Snap+Camera pode transformar suas experiências de captura!

To share Download PDF

Gostou do artigo? Deixe sua avaliação!
Sua opinião é muito importante para nós. Clique em um dos botões abaixo para nos dizer o que achou deste conteúdo.